Saturday 3rd December (A Welsh Walk)


Mr. Kite looked out of his bedroom window into a cloudy sky. After yesterday party and gallons of beer Mr. Kite was still unstable and not in a fit state but soon he was being driven towards Dolgellau for a  walk along a ridge and a days bird watching.

To cut a long story short the drive to Cader Idris produced the usual sightings; magpies, carrion crows etc. The spectacular views on the ridge over the Mawddach estuary towards Barmouth produced herrings gulls and plenty of ravens. In the strong winds a few birds came into view and then suddenly far away. Towards the end of the walk a brownish bird, about the same size as a wheatear, with dark legs and a black tail was briefly spotted. In the strong wind it was difficult to focus steadily on it and it remained unidentified.

The final part of the walk was completely under the cover of darkness. Mr. Kite returned home for a tipple of Morland "Old Speckled Hen". Cheers.
